Hi! My name is Jared Reed.

This project, radiolivearts.com, is born out of a love of spoken word performance—mostly audio drama and old-time radio programs, but also anything where the connection between word, speaker, and audience is at its most focused.

My personal tastes run to the classical, but that’s mostly from drama school training; as well as murder mysteries, but that’s mostly due to temperment. My hope here is to create the digital storing house for the performance experiments that we create.

Thank you for reading this far and enjoy your time here.

BIO

Jared Reed is an actor, writer, director, and live and digital event producer with 30 years experience.

As a theatre and live event producer, he has brought new and established works to audiences of all demographics and interests, working as an actor, director, writer, educator, and producer nationally and internationally, and here at Philadelphia companies including Curio Theatre Company (co-founder); The Walnut Street Theatre; Bristol Riverside; Philadelphia Artists Collective; and Hedgerow Theatre, where he was a company member from 1990 to 2020 and Producing Artistic Director 2016 to 2020. Jared is a graduate of the Juilliard School, Drama Division, Group 24. As a writer, he has been produced in a variety of mediums. As an educator, he has taught at The University of the Arts, Arcadia University, and others, as well as conceived and led multiple workshops in theatre education for all age and skill levels.
